1. Neck injuries. Neck injuries can result from accidents but are often the result of posture while sitting at work or performing other routine tasks. Along with treating your discomfort with gentle chiropractic adjustments, we can help you learn how to avoid neck injuries and pain.

Proper posture, appropriate exercise, regular stretching, and even adjusting your office chair and monitor can help to solve chronic neck injuries. Even changing your habits, such as no longer looking down at your cell phone, can reduce your symptoms.

2. Back injuries. Back injuries are the number one cause for workers compensation claims and filings for disability benefits. More than 80 percent of us will suffer from low back pain at some point. Many different types of injuries or misalignments can result in back pain, and many family doctors lack the training to correctly identify the cause of the problem.

Chiropractors specialize in not only identifying the cause of back pain, but in helping patients to resolve the problem. We will assess your specific situation, make recommendations that can help improve your condition, and offer chiropractic adjustments that can bring quicker relief.

3. Sports injuries. The majority of sports injuries are related to soft tissue accidents or are related to body mechanics. Whether you’re a student athlete, professional athlete, or just a weekend warrior, chiropractic care can help to uncover the underlying issues that caused your injury in the first place.

We can assess you for improper technique and conditioning, muscular imbalances, and biomechanical deficiencies. Then together we will treat your pain while helping you to avoid re-injury.
